car•am•bo•la (Noun)

Source: The American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, Fourth Edition

1. An ornamental evergreen tree (Averrhoa carambola), native to southeast Asia and having crisp, edible, yellow to orange, longitudinally ridged fruits that are star-shaped in cross section.
2. The fruit of this plant. Also called star fruit.
CARAMBOLA
An East Indian tree (Averrhoa Carambola), and its acid, juicy fruit; called also Coromandel gooseberry.

CARAMBOLA
n 1: East Indian tree bearing deeply ridged yellow-brown fruit [syn: carambola tree, Averrhoa carambola] 2: deeply ridged yellow-brown tropical fruit; used raw as a vegetable or in salad or when fully ripe as a dessert [syn: star fruit].
